Transaction 173ac0b75b9528cfce9041ed622322e151c29fe7345da027090ae49efafaf3f3
1 Input
1 Output
-
173ac0b75b9528cfce9041ed622322e151c29fe7345da027090ae49efafaf3f3:0
- value
- 34736
- script pubkey
- OP_0 OP_PUSHBYTES_32 9eb483e12dee696746e99d5db155ce371d95f8a3c763f110f55b84e51d49a7f3
- address
- bc1qn66g8cfdae5kw3hfn4wmz4wwxuwet79rca3lzy84twzw282f5leshcge49